SUMMARY:Saratoga County History Roundtable Event: The Brothers Low
DESCRIPTION:Sam McKenzie\, Brookside museum researcher\, will discuss the lives of Isaac and Nicholas Low\, successful 18th century merchants and land speculators. New York City men to the core\, they nevertheless cast a long shadow in Northern New York State and in the Village of Ballston Spa in particular. One became embroiled in the politics of the War of Independence\, and was destroyed by it. The other remained aloof and profited hugely. Their divergent paths and their influence on the early history of Saratoga County will be examined. This program is free and open to the public\, though donations are gratefully accepted.
